You are buying a pair of Pyramid style crystal footed shakers made by the Indiana Glass Co. in the 1930s. These weren’t really part of the Pyramid pattern, they just go with the Pyramid pattern and the collectors of this pattern use them since they go-with it so nicely. Horseshoe is the collector's name for Indiana Glass Company's pattern No. 612. Produced from 1930 to 1933, it's a lovely pattern that's as popular today as it was when it was first made.
